hi im byron adele founder and CEO of a q quote since 1986 a q quote has helped hundreds of thousands of people just like you save a fortune on their life insurance most life insurance policies offer an optional feature called waiver of premium this feature was invented years ago when life insurance companies discovered that many of the policies would lapse when their customers became disabled and could no longer work now lets face it when you become disabled and you have no income food and shelter take a front seat and stuff like life insurance typically is scrapped the way this valuable feature works is that if you become totally disabled typically before the age of 60 the life insurance company will literally pay your premium for you beginning in month seven of your disability and theyll continue to pay those premiums for you for as long as youre disabled obviously the terms and conditions vary by carrier but thats generally how it works now here are a few things to consider as
